Dreamt for Light Years in the Belly of a Mountain The long-awaited and much-anticipated new album from Mark Linkous (aka SPARKLEHORSE), Dreamt for Light is rife with fuzzed-out grace and dark enchantment, featuring musical contributions by Danger Mouse, Tom Waits, and Steven Drozd of The Flaming Lips.
